A Professional Certificate in Environmental Conflict Resolution equips professionals with crucial skills for navigating complex environmental disputes. The program focuses on developing effective coping strategies for managing disagreements related to natural resource management, pollution control, and conservation efforts.
Learning outcomes include mastering negotiation techniques, mediation skills, and conflict analysis. Participants will gain a deep understanding of environmental law and policy, facilitating their ability to resolve conflicts constructively. This also includes familiarity with stakeholder engagement and collaborative problem-solving approaches within environmental management.
The program duration typically ranges from several weeks to a few months, depending on the specific institution and delivery format (online or in-person). The curriculum is designed to be flexible and adaptable to different professional schedules, incorporating case studies and real-world scenarios.
